#dc400b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#dc400b is composed of 86.3% red, 25.1% green and 4.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 70.9% magenta, 95%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 15.2 degrees, a saturation of 90.5% and a lightness of 45.3%. #dc400b color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8016 with #b90000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3300.

Shades and Tints of #dc400b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0401 is the darkest color, while #fffcf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#dc400b

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7a706d is the less saturated color, while #e53c02 is the most saturated one.
